Hello! I am a Licensed Professional Clinical Counselor (LPCC) and Licensed Drug and Alcohol Counselor. I specialize in working with youth, young adults, and adults who struggle with mental health and/or chemical health issues, as well as life transitions and stressors related to those age groups.
The most common symptoms or concerns that I treat include depression, anxiety, trauma/PTSD, addiction, parenting support, as well as children of addicted/alcoholic parents and families issues.
